The indonesia industrial racking system market was estimated at USD 229 Million in 2025 and is projected to reach USD 302 Million by 2032, growing at a CAGR of 5.1% from 2026 to 2032.
The Indonesia industrial racking system market is witnessing a notable upward trend, rebounding from a slight decline of 0.9% in 2021 to a promising growth of 5.6% in 2023. Factors driving this resurgence include an expanding manufacturing sector, enhanced logistics infrastructure, and increased investments in digitalization, which have heightened operational efficiency. As Indonesia transitions towards a more robust energy policy, the demand for efficient storage solutions continues to climb, with anticipated growth rates of 5.7% in 2024 and 5.2% in 2025. This momentum is supported by rising consumer demand and ongoing improvements in supply chain management, paving the way for sustained growth through 2032.

The table below presents the year wise growth rates along with the key drivers influencing the market
| Year | Growth Rate | Major Drivers |
| 2021 | -0.9% | Supply chain disruptions severely hampered project timelines, leading to decreased investment in industrial racking systems. |
| 2022 | 4.3% | E-commerce growth necessitates optimized warehousing capabilities to enhance operational efficiency. |
| 2023 | 5.6% | Localization trends encourage investments in domestic manufacturing and distribution infrastructure. |
| 2024 | 5.7% | Urbanization pressures increase the need for vertical storage in densely populated areas. |
| 2025 | 5.2% | Investment in logistics technology enhances supply chain visibility and efficiency across industries. |
| 2026 | 5.1% | Warehouse automation projects prompt increased adoption of advanced racking systems for flexibility. |
| 2027 | 5.3% | Emerging sectors like renewable energy require specialized racking solutions for storage needs. |
| 2028 | 5.6% | Corporate sustainability initiatives drive the demand for eco-friendly racking materials and designs. |
| 2029 | 5.2% | Infrastructure improvements enhance supply chain logistics, promoting the racking system market. |
| 2030 | 5.1% | Digital transformation in industries influences the development of smart racking systems. |
| 2031 | 5.3% | Increased foreign direct investment in manufacturing boosts racking system installations significantly. |
| 2032 | 5.2% | Competitive pressures among retailers compel innovations in storage solutions for enhanced productivity. |

The Indonesia Industrial Racking System Market is projected to reach 5.1% and witness significant growth during the forecast period (2026-2032). This growth is primarily driven by the increasing demand for efficient and safe storage solutions across various industries. The adoption of industrial racking systems is gaining momentum in sectors such as automotive, electronics, food processing, warehousing, and logistics, among others, due to their cost-effectiveness and operational convenience.
Several key factors are propelling the growth of the Indonesia Industrial Racking System Market. The need for advanced storage systems that maximize space utilization while ensuring compatibility with a diverse range of goods plays a crucial role in this market's expansion. As industrial operations seek to reduce operating costs, the reduction of transportation time and labor costs through efficient storage solutions becomes increasingly critical.
Trends in the Indonesia Industrial Racking System Market indicate a shift towards automation and technological integration. Businesses are increasingly focusing on warehouse management solutions that incorporate automated systems to improve throughput and reduce labor dependency. The demand for innovative racking solutions that offer enhanced storage capacity aligns with the rapid growth of various industries, providing ample opportunities for market stakeholders.
While the Indonesia Industrial Racking System Market showcases significant growth potential, several challenges may hinder its progress. A notable concern is the reliance on imported racking systems, which can lead to higher installation costs and may limit accessibility for small-scale industries.
The government of Indonesia is actively investing in infrastructure and industrial development, which consequently impacts the Industrial Racking System Market. Increased public spending in logistics and transportation infrastructure is essential for enhancing storage and distribution capabilities across various sectors.
Recent developments in the Indonesia Industrial Racking System Market have showcased a trend towards modernization and technological integration. Companies are increasingly adopting automated handling systems that complement their racking solutions, leading to improved operational efficiency. Industry stakeholders are focusing on research and development to innovate products that meet evolving market needs, particularly in the context of increased e-commerce activity.
